Publication | Closed Access
Chippe: a system for constraint driven behavioral synthesis
87
Citations
23
References
1990
Year
Artificial IntelligenceEngineeringComputer ArchitectureSystem-level DesignSystem SynthesisComputer-aided DesignEmbedded SystemsHardware SystemsOptimal System DesignConstraint SolvingComputer DesignDigital DesignRobot LearningChippe SystemDesignComputer EngineeringComputer ScienceSoftware DesignLogic SynthesisAutomated ReasoningProgram AnalysisDesign SynthesisAutomationFormal MethodsProgram SynthesisNext IterationBehavioral Synthesis
The Chippe system for constrained behavioural architecture synthesis uses a novel closed-loop design iteration technique in which the present state of the design is analyzed with respect to the goals and then modified for the next iteration. In this way the design state is iteratively driven towards meeting the global constraints imposed by the designer. The design synthesis is performed by a set of algorithmic tools specially constructed to permit the imposition of a wide variety of local constraints, and by a rule-based system which makes design analysis and modification decisions to set these local constraints. Key to these decisions is a design evaluator which examines the present state of the design and interactively reports its findings to the rule-based system. The closed-loop iteration strategy, the interaction between the rule base and the tools, and the evaluation performed to support the design decisions are detailed. Also presented are results from sample designs, including designs for the TMS320 digital signal processor chip.< <ETX xmlns:mml="http://www.w3.org/1998/Math/MathML" xmlns:xlink="http://www.w3.org/1999/xlink">></ETX>
| Year | Citations | |
|---|---|---|
Page 1
Page 1